I believe that in order to help a student you must first be able to connect with him/her. That could mean understanding a student’s background, researching the latest video games or playing softball after class. For example, several of the girls I worked with at the JEI Learning Center, spoke very little English. Often they got frustrated and just sort of shut down -- stopped responding. At first I tried to have them draw pictures but when that didn't work, I asked them to show me something from home. They folded cranes and strawberries out of the paper that I gave them. Though the exercise didn't help them understand verb tense, it did help build trust between us. After that, when they felt insecure or confused, I was less intimidating.
